Orienteering race 16:42:54 [4] 60.54 km (16:34 / km) +6758ft 14:09 / km
shoes: Salomon Fellraiser

World Rogaining Championships. My Garmin 500 is only good for about 18 hours, and we had to bag it 2+ hours prior to the start, so I didn't get all of our distance. I would put us at 65k overall.

We naved well for the most part. 1:33k map, so there was some detail missing for sure. We didn't have any issues with control location, but roads stopped (on the map) and kept going on the ground, roads missing, etc. We compensated and kept plugging.

We had a bobble on our third control, which was on a small feature in thick woods. We took some conservative routes, which aided in finding controls, but definitely added distance. We also planned one control sequence of 3 controls poorly.

In the end, we went to have fun, and we did. When it stopped being fun due to Clark's feet and my general lack of fitness due to issues with my calf... we called it a day.

28 controls. 1600 points.
